JuggleJS

A JavaScript site-swap juggling patterns interpreter and simulator.

Definitions

  • Prop - object used for juggling
  • Site-swaps - popular notation for recording patterns
  • Pattern - specific sequence of prop manipulations - throws, stalls, bounces, etc
  • Beat/Tick - the start of each manipulation defines a beat (0 being the null/empty manipulation)

Site-swaps

Initially hold the X and Z ball in your right hand and the Y ball in your left. Let's execute the 441 pattern. Props - X, Y, Z (3 balls) Alternating "hands" L - left hand, R - right hand
RLRLRLRLR XYZZXYYXZ Let's break it down. First we throw the X ball from our right, it will fall on the 4th beat. The next beat is from the left hand. LRLRLRLR YZ-X Throw the Y ball from the left hand, again it will fall on the 4th beat. Right hand next. RLRLRLRL Z-XY Throw the ball across, it will fall on the next beat (in the other hand) LRLRLRLR ZXY You can now start the pattern again; this time left hand first, or do a different pattern altogether.

Example Patterns

531, 3, 441, 501, 40, 423, [53]01, [54]21

Verification

sum of numbers / count must be integer and constitutes the number of balls
